Suspect in Elkhart hit-and-run identified
Posted: 10/04/2012 at 1:15 am


A man who was arrested following a police chase Tuesday evening has been identified as Bobby Johnson.

Johnson, 25, of 52081 Conrad St., was taken to the Elkhart County Jail for criminal recklessness, leaving the scene of an accident and carjacking, according to a booking report from the jail.

According to witnesses, Johnson was at the VFW Post 88 on 1519 W. Bristol St. for about an hour and claimed to be the vice-president of the Dirty White Boys Gang.

George Morehouse, one of the witnesses, said he saw Hal Spratt trying to pull Johnson out of a van. Johnson reversed and pulled forward, striking Spratt at least twice.

Lt. Laura Koch, public information officer at the Elkhart Police Department, said police were called around 5:17 p.m. Johnson fled in the vehicle and later on foot. He was caught around 5:48 p.m.

Johnson has a long criminal history involving possession of narcotics, theft and identity deception according to Elkhart County Jail records. Koch said Johnson was not registered as a gang member.

Spratt was taken to the hospital, where he was treated and released.
